I got up at 5:15 this morning with the intention of going back to Coed Llandegla to try see once more to see the Black Grouse. The good news was that the weather was pretty good it was cold but there was no low cloud and no sign of rain either. So I wrapped up warm and set off. What I hadn’t realised was that the climb to the hide via the public footpath was much steeper than the walk I had last week in the mist

When I arrived at the hide I was pleased to see to gents who had been with us on the walk on friday they had the good news that the grouse were present and showing well. What a relief! :-) The grouse are beautiful bird with big white back ends and lovely red tufts above the eyes. I am very relieved to have seen them.

There were other great birds in the area including a Redstart two Redpoll and a couple of Garden Warblers.

I also visited Worlds End today where I had good views of a Tree Pipit.

My last visit of the day was to Inner Marsh Farm where I was please to find lots of Warblers and Black Tailed Godwits. The best bird hear was probably the Cuckoo that decided to sit on a fence for a couple of minutes.
